A server for changing control gains of a vehicle is disclosed. The server includes
a first receiver for receiving environment data obtained by vehicles of a plurality
of users running in specific areas, and a second receiver for receiving learned
data obtained by a plurality of users operating vehicles, and a storage device
for accumulating the environment data and the learned data. The server further
includes a transmitter for fetching environment data and learned data necessary
to produce control gains from among the accumulated environment data and the learned
data and transmitting the fetched environment data and learned data to a user requesting
the environment data and the learned data. In a vehicle of the user, the control
gains are newly produced and previously produced control gains are changed to the
newly produced ones.